Dental asymmetry as a measure of environmental stress in the Ticuna Indians of Colombia.

TL;DR: The magnitude of fluctuating dental asymmetry is reported for a marginally Westernized, horticultural Indian group, the Ticuna of the Region Amazonas, Colombia, which accords with the adequacy and reliability of traditional food sources and complements the claim that protein intake is at or above minimum requirements.

Tooth size of Ticuna Indians, Colombia, with phenetic comparisons to other Amerindians

TL;DR: This study reports an odontometric analyses of unadmixed, adult Ticuna Indians, Colombia, South America, characterized by crown diameters intermediate in size relative to the known Amerindian range and, in turn, to the range in modern man.
